The 2016 Suzuki Kizashi GLX Sedan is a versatile and reliable vehicle, known for its 2.4L 2393CC inline-4 DOHC naturally aspirated engine. This front-wheel-drive sedan offers a practical combination of performance and efficiency. The Kizashi's stylish design, coupled with a well-crafted interior, makes it a compelling choice for those seeking a balance between comfort and affordability. As a 4-door sedan, it provides ample space for passengers, making it suitable for both daily commutes and longer journeys.
Common Issues
- Transmission Problems: Some users have reported issues with the CVT transmission, including shuddering and delayed shifts.
- Suspension Concerns: Premature wear on suspension components such as bushings and struts may occur.
- Electrical Issues: Problems with the electrical system, including faulty sensors and wiring, can occasionally arise.
Maintenance Tips
- Regular oil changes every 5,000 to 7,500 miles to ensure engine longevity.
- Inspect and replace brake pads and rotors as needed to maintain optimal braking performance.
- Check and maintain tire pressure regularly for improved fuel efficiency and safety.
- Schedule regular inspections of the suspension system to catch and repair issues early.
Cost Ranges
- Oil Change: $50 - $100
- Brake Pad Replacement: $150 - $300 per axle
- CVT Transmission Repair: $1,000 - $3,500
- Suspension Repair: $200 - $1,000 depending on the parts and labor needed

FAQs
- What is the fuel economy of the 2016 Suzuki Kizashi GLX? The Kizashi typically offers around 23 mpg city and 30 mpg highway, depending on driving conditions and maintenance.
- Is the 2016 Suzuki Kizashi a reliable car? Generally, the Kizashi is considered reliable, though it's important to keep up with regular maintenance to prevent common issues.
- Does the Suzuki Kizashi require premium fuel? No, the Kizashi is designed to run efficiently on regular unleaded gasoline.
